Mirror of Madness
Japanese edition of the Finnish heavy metal act's 2003 album includes one bonus track, 'Smash'. Avalon.
Manufacturer: Avalon Japan
Release date: 31 March 2003
EAN: 4527516003579
My tags:
Release date: 31 March 2003
EAN: 4527516003579
